Lawyers poised to receive deposed CJ

Source: OUR STAFF REPORTER June 10, 2008

The deposed CJP is going to have his third visit to the city after action against him on March 9 last year by General Pervez Musharraf. He had reached the City on May 6 last after 26-hour travel from Islamabad through GT Road while leading a big procession of lawyers, political workers, general public, civil society and others. He was accorded a grand welcome by lakhs of people belonging to every walk of life. He visited the City second time on July 17 last year on the invitation of Lahore Bar Association (LBA) and it took him about 10 hours to reach the venue from the airport.

Justice Chaudhry's today visit of the Bar aimed at addressing the joint meeting of the Supreme Court Bar Association, Lahore High Court Bar, Lahore Bar Association, and Lahore Tax Bar. Thousands of long marchers who gathered in Mutlan from Karachi, Hyderabad, Quetta, Sibi, Sukkar, DG Khan, Lodhran and other parts of the country will throng the City today to hear the CJP. They will move to Islamabad in the morning on June 12 along with a huge number of lawyers, civil society men, traders, professionals, ulema, students, workers, political workers and others in the City. On the way to the destination the marchers will be joined by those, expectedly in thousands, from northern Pakistan and AJK.
